By contrast, santo domingo was a small colony with little impact on the economy of spain. Prosperous french plantation owners sought to maximize their gain through increased production for a growing world market. Thus, they imported great numbers of slaves from africa and drove this captive work force ruthlessly.

In 1822, haitian president jean-pierre boyer invaded santo domingo for the third time with the intent of unifying the island. The subsequent 22-year occupation would result not only in the economic and cultural deterioration of santo domingo but also in a resentment of haiti by the dominicans.
